West Virginia University - News and Information ServicesWhen the state’s Higher Education Policy Commission meets Friday (Sept. 21) on the West Virginia University campus, the agenda will include allocation of funding from the Legislature for community college and technical education and special projects.
Chancellor J. Michael Mullen will present preliminary estimates of fall headcount enrollment at each of the state’s public colleges and universities.
